Belarusian athletes win 24 medals and set three national records
11.05.2018
At the 17th summer world gymnasiade, Belarusian athletes won 24 medals – five gold, seven silver and 12 bronze medals.
In the homeland, the triumphants were warmly met by relatives, friends, and coaches. The greatest success was achieved by Belarusian athletes in rhythmic gymnastics, track and field athletics, swimming and women's wrestling.
Three national records have been established: two in swimming, one in athletics.
